Knit Dyeing: Dyeing process of any kinds of knitted fabrics using dyeing, chemicals & other agents is known as knit dyeing. It is mostly similar to yarn dyeing process. Some quality & other technical parameters are different between knit dyeing & yarn dyeing. Knitted fabrics dyeing commonly done by batch wise process. Most common process sequence of knit dyeing is given below:
